Armenian, Swedish Foreign Ministers Discuss Karabakh Crisis

The foreign ministers of Armenia and Sweden, by telephone today, discussed the humanitarian crisis in Karabakh due to Azerbaijan’s illegal blockade of the Lachin Corridor.

Armenian Foreign Minister Ararat Mirzoyan and his Swedish counterpart, Tobias Billström, referred to the August 16 meeting of the U.N. Security Council and the calls by most members to reopen the roadway in accordance with the findings of the International Court of Justice.

The importance of the effective use of all mechanisms in this direction, including by the E.U. and its member states, was emphasized, given that the ongoing deterioration of the humanitarian situation in Nagorno-Karabakh could also seriously jeopardize efforts aimed at establishing stability in the region.
